1857 Augt 26th Raining this morning fine weather
fine weather, cutting out shoes shelling Corn
spining worming & succoring Tobacco at new
ground —, Sent Arch & Lowry back to day
Finished at new ground rained all evening
27th Rained all night & still continues this morning
We are doing but little making Baskets
etc turned a little cool, no weather to maintain
wheat. Henry made 2 rakes yesterday,
28th Rained tremendous hard all day yesterday
This morning cleared off & fine weather
Henry making cart tongue etc etc Balance
Balance working on road from here to Stony
pint etc etc, expect to go to mill to day
29th worming & succoring Tobacco at Johns Branch
toping at new ground Henry & Jordan
Sandy & little Henry gone to Capt Gilberts after
Cotton fine weather for every thing to grow,
30th Fair clear day for Sunday school
31st & Sept 1st Thrashed wheat & finished about 3 Oclock
and top Tobacco & wormed & succored -
Sept 2 I went to see Miss Sarah McCullock
Toping Tobacco over close worming & succoring
3rd Daubing barn & finishing Toping Tobacco
in evening pulling fodder at stoney p[o]int
& Halling up primings. — Mrs Hunt here
went down to Pringles for her.
4. Daubing Barn at Crews halling up
primings from new ground --
Expect to start to Raise barn to day
cloudy & like for Rain this morning
got 3 or 4 Logs round Daubing weaving
House & barn back of Garden cloudy &
Raining a little my wife Jerry & Sallie
is gone to Fannies Sallie starts to school
5th Rained Hard last night, firing primings
working on Barn at mountain this morning
clearing of[f] Sallie starts to school 7th Sept.
